Programming Transmitters to the Vehicle

Only keyless access transmitters programmed to the vehicle will work.

If a transmitter is lost or stolen, a replacement can be purchased and programmed through your dealer.

The vehicle can be reprogrammed so that lost or stolen transmitters no longer work. Each vehicle can have up to four transmitters matched to it.
